What are overlay strategies?

Overlay strategies are investment strategies that use derivative investment vehicles to obtain, offset or substitute specific portfolio exposures, beyond those provided by the underlying portfolio assets. They allow pension fund sponsors to increase or reduce exposure in a fund, relative to its actual funded amount.

The strategies generally involve a synthetic replication of an asset class, market or factor exposure, such as portable alpha, foreign exchange overlays, rebalancing, liability-driven investments, cash equitization, hedge fund replication, and completion overlay.

The fair value of the overlay portfolio is often very small or even zero because it is generally funded and implemented by using derivatives. The overlay portfolio can be highly leveraged as a result of using derivatives.

Clearing

As a central counterparty, CME Clearing acts as the buyer to every seller and seller to every buyer to ensure the financial security of the marketplace and reduce clearing participants counterparty risk and achieve operational and financial efficiency.
